JSC FGC UES Branch – Backbone electric grids (MES) of South – has completed construction of cable power line 110 kV Poselkovaya – Rosa Khutor (Krasnodar Territory of Russia). Works were undertaken within the Federal target program “Development of the town of Sochi as the mountain climatic resort (2006-2014)”. The new power line is designed for power supply to the settlement of Krasnaya Polyana – the main site of the 2014 Olympic Games.

Power transmission line 110 kV Poselkovaya – Rosa Khutor with the length of about 5 km crosses the territory of Sochi national park. Due to cable version the unique flora and wildlife sanctuary environment was entirely preserved. The line route crosses two creeks – Rzhanoy and Bezymyanny.

Temporary for the period of construction the creeks were switched to new water courses and later returned to their former courses. Both circuits of the line are laid in special channels and run in one cut enabling facilitating the work and reducing cost of construction significantly.

Cable power lines with cross-linked polyethylene insulation have a number of advantages as compared to overhead transmission lines – they are more eco-friendly, safe and reliable in operation.

Till the end of 2010 five cable power lines 110 kV will be built in the area of the settlement of Krasnaya Polyana with total length of 27 km. They will provide for power supply to the 2014 Olympic Games facilities under construction including winter sports center, snowboard park, etc.

JSC FGC UES carries out construction and renovation of electric grid facilities for the 2014 Olympic Games power supply in accordance with timetable set forth by the International Olympic committee and the Federal target program “Development of the town of Sochi as the mountain climatic resort”. Totally during 2009-2014 FGC will construct, upgrade and renovate 21 backbone electric grid facilities on the territory of Sochi region.
